Ticket: ScrubKit metadata vault locked after failed plugin signing attempts. External plugin authors cannot currently publish EXIF-scrubbing extensions because the vault holding the signing certificates auto-locked after three bad attempts during yesterday's release. GPS and timestamp scrubbing in production is unaffected; only plugin publication is blocked. To unlock, run the vault recovery tool from the ScrubKit dev console and enter the recovery passphrase, which is recorded on the line directly below.

strongbox words: wenix-ulador

## Tailing logs with `grimfeed`

Welcome to on-call! When something breaks at 3 a.m., `grimfeed` is your friend. Run `grimfeed tail --service payments` to stream live logs, or add `--since 15m` to rewind a bit. Filters stack, so pile on `--level error` when things get noisy.

If the auth cache dies mid-incident (it happens), `grimfeed` will prompt you for the emergency recovery passphrase. Keep it handy but never paste it in chat. Here it is:

recovery phrase for bawef-haduf: wenax-druox-julmir

Leadership Review Briefing — Closure of the Pellbrook Office. The Pellbrook site serves eleven staff and has run below capacity for two years. Lease expiry falls in October, making closure the lowest-cost option. Eight roles transfer to the Harrowden hub; three are under consultation. Client coverage shifts to the regional team without service changes. Annualised savings are estimated at 340,000. The incoming director should review the consultation timeline first. The board's confidential intent is stated below.

management briefing: Project Ulavan slips by two quarters because of the staffing delay.